How they compare
Sub-Saharan Africa currently reports 4.39 billion BoP, current US$ against 4.18 billion BoP, current US$ in Pakistan, a difference of 206.16 million BoP, current US$.
Across all 20 years both countries report, Sub-Saharan Africa has been ahead every year.
Pakistan ranks 38th and Sub-Saharan Africa ranks 37th of 189 countries.
Sub-Saharan Africa has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

About this data
Information and communication technology service exports include computer and communications services (telecommunications and postal and courier services) and information services (computer data and news-related service transactions). Data are in current U.S. dollars.
